Explore the foundations of de Branges-Rovnyak spaces in this comprehensive lecture from the Focus Program on Analytic Function Spaces and their Applications. Delve into key concepts including notation, historical context, multipliers, and Bronzerovnik spaces. Examine range spaces, general lemmas, and various types of Rovnyak spaces. Investigate the Douglas lemma and its proof, along with antifunctions and boundary behavior. Gain valuable insights from Dan Timotin of the Simion Stoilow Institute of Mathematics as he presents this in-depth exploration of complex analysis and functional theory.
